Hi Dave,

I think what you want here is:
cdo -f nc import_binary test.ctl ofile.nc

The error you're getting indicates you're missing the required CDO
operator ("import_binary" in this case). The ctl file is enough to
identify the input binary file.

> [1] You can read binary files in NCL. NCL does not require nc.
>
> [2] When reading binary in NCL, you can preset how NCL handles binary.
>
> http://www.ncl.ucar.edu/Document/Functions/Built-in/setfileoption.shtml
>
> setfileoption("bin","ReadByteOrder","LittleEndian")
>
> [3] The Examples URL has a section on reading/converting "GrADS files"
> (a binary file with a text file describing how the file
> was written.)
>
>
> http://www.ncl.ucar.edu/Applications/
> See Miscellaneous at bottom
>
> If you insall the Climate Data Operators, their
> command line utilitry is the way to go.
>
>
> cdo -f nc import_binary file.ctl ofile.nc <http://ofile.nc>

> > Hi Dave,
> >
> > This is a very strange error indeed. "writematrix.f" is the
> underlying Fortran code for the "write_matrix"
> > procedure. Both this code and the C wrapper are "built into" the
> "ncl" executable, so there shouldn't
> > be any issue with using it.
> >
> > I wonder if maybe it's a compatibility issue with the version of
> NCL you downloaded for your system.
> >
> > I would recommend upgrading to NCL V6.0.0, and trying one of
> those binaries instead.
> >
> > What version of gcc are you running? This might affect which
> binary you download.
> >
> > gcc --version
> >
> > For NCL V6.0.0, we offer binaries that were compiled with gcc
> 4.3.2, gcc 4.4.5, and gcc 4.1.2.
> > I tend to like the Debian binaries, as they seem to work well
> across many flavors of Linux.
> > I've had trouble with using the RedHat binaries on other
> non-RedHat systems.
